PHP

Imagick PHP如何实现图片旋转

小樊
83
2024-08-13 17:47:38
栏目: 编程语言

你可以使用 Imagick PHP 扩展中的 rotateImage() 方法来实现图片旋转。下面是一个简单的示例代码:

// 创建一个 Imagick 对象
$image = new Imagick('path/to/your/image.jpg');

// 旋转图片90度
$image->rotateImage(new ImagickPixel(), 90);

// 保存旋转后的图片
$image->writeImage('path/to/save/rotated/image.jpg');

// 释放内存
$image->clear();
$image->destroy();

在上面的示例中,我们首先创建一个 Imagick 对象并加载需要旋转的图片。然后使用 rotateImage() 方法来对图片进行旋转,传入一个 ImagickPixel 对象作为参数(可以传入空的 ImagickPixel 对象)。最后保存旋转后的图片并释放内存。

你可以根据自己的需要调整旋转角度和保存路径。希望这可以帮助到你。

0
看了该问题的人还看了